Assistive Technology Tools
Assistive technology devices play an important function in supporting people with dyslexia by making reading and composing jobs more obtainable. These tools can substantially improve your learning experience and improve your self-confidence.
One popular choice is text-to-speech software application, which reviews text out loud, helping you much better comprehend written material. This attribute is especially useful for prolonged papers or books.
One more efficient device is speech-to-text software program. By allowing you to speak your ideas as opposed to typing them, it lessens the difficulties you could face with punctuation and writing fluency.
Additionally, word forecast software application can aid you by suggesting words as you kind, making it less complicated to express your concepts without obtaining stuck.
E-readers and digital platforms often feature customizable setups that let you change font size, history color, and spacing, helping in reducing aesthetic stress.
Ultimately, applications developed to reinforce phonological understanding and analysis abilities can offer appealing method in a fun style.
Speech and Language Treatment
Along with assistive technology, speech and language treatment can be a valuable resource for people with dyslexia. This treatment focuses on boosting your interaction abilities, which can dramatically affect your reading and creating abilities. A competent speech-language pathologist will examine your details demands and develop a customized strategy to resolve them.
During treatment sessions, you'll engage in workouts that target phonemic understanding, vocabulary building, and language comprehension. By improving these fundamental skills, you'll find it simpler to translate words and understand texts. The specialist might also offer approaches to help you self-monitor your analysis and writing, enabling you to end up being a lot more independent in your knowing.
Furthermore, speech and language therapy isn't practically reading; it additionally aids you reveal your ideas more plainly. This can enhance your confidence in class discussions and social communications.
Adult Participation Approaches
Parental involvement plays a crucial duty in sustaining children with dyslexia, as moms and dads can directly influence their kid's learning journey. By proactively participating in your youngster's education and learning, you can help them get over challenges and develop self-confidence.
Below are some efficient strategies you can use:
1. ** Create an encouraging home atmosphere **: Assign a silent, well-lit area for analysis and homework. Make certain your kid feels comfy and encouraged to ask inquiries.
2. ** Urge routine analysis **: Read with each other daily, selecting publications that match their rate of interests and checking out level. This technique boosts their skills and cultivates a love for literature.
3. ** Communicate with teachers **: Keep open lines of interaction with your child's instructors. Frequently review your kid's progress and any kind of concerns. Partnership can lead to a lot more customized support.
4. ** Celebrate accomplishments **: Recognize and celebrate your kid's successes, no matter exactly how little. Positive reinforcement increases their motivation and self-confidence, making them more eager to discover.
